How they compare
Ghana currently reports 9.86 Mt CO2e against 9.73 Mt CO2e in Azerbaijan, a difference of 0.13 Mt CO2e.
The two have swapped places 11 times across 55 shared years of data; in 1970 it was Azerbaijan ahead.
Azerbaijan ranks 72nd and Ghana ranks 71st of 194 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Azerbaijan averaged higher in 4 and Ghana in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Azerbaijan | Ghana |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 3.22 Mt CO2e | 1.18 Mt CO2e | 2.04 Mt CO2e | Azerbaijan |
| 1980s | 4.47 Mt CO2e | 1.32 Mt CO2e | 3.15 Mt CO2e | Azerbaijan |
| 1990s | 3.57 Mt CO2e | 2.11 Mt CO2e | 1.47 Mt CO2e | Azerbaijan |
| 2000s | 3.67 Mt CO2e | 3.58 Mt CO2e | 0.092 Mt CO2e | Azerbaijan |
| 2010s | 6.99 Mt CO2e | 7.11 Mt CO2e | 0.125 Mt CO2e | Ghana |
| 2020s | 8.65 Mt CO2e | 9.91 Mt CO2e | 1.26 Mt CO2e | Ghana |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
A measure of annual emissions of carbon dioxide (CO2), one of the six Kyoto greenhouse gases (GHG), from the transportation sector (subsector of the energy sector) including IPCC 2006 codes 1.A.3.a Civil Aviation, 1.A.3.b_noRES Road Transportation no resuspension, 1.A.3.c Railways, 1.A.3.d Water-borne Navigation, 1.A.3.e Other Transportation. The measure is standardized to carbon dioxide equivalent values using the Global Warming Potential (GWP) factors of IPCC's 5th Assessment Report (AR5).
